Feasterville-Trevose, Pennsylvania, USA - In a striking campaign appearance, the Republican presidential candidate Donald Trump caused excitement in a McDonald’s branch in Feasteaville Trevose, Pennsylvania. The visit, which is seen as a direct answer to his democratic competitor Kamala Harris, was staged by Trump himself to present himself as a man of the people. "I wanted to do it all my life. And now I'm doing it," Trump explained with a big grin and a pushing overhang before going to the kitchen of the fast food restaurant. There he fried fries fries and then submitted orders on the drive-through window.
Hinterstent background of his appearance is that Harris is said to have worked in a McDonald’s during her studies, which she repeatedly emphasized in the election campaign. Trump's team, on the other hand, doubts the authenticity of this statement, which remains without valid evidence. Media attention also achieved the topic by asking the “New York Times” McDonald’s but received no statement. This raises questions about why the company sticks out of this political debate.
campaign strategies in the crossfire
Trump’s appearance was not only a marketing move, but also a clever attempt to sow doubts about the statements of his internal rival. He gives himself as someone who maintains contact with the "simple population", while at the same time fueling conspiracy theories. This can also be seen in his handling of the results of the 2020 presidential election, where he spoke of election fraud - without evidence.
Even during his visit, Trump made funny comments about Harris ’upcoming 60th birthday, with the words:" I think I will give her a few flowers, maybe a few fries. " Such sayings show his ability to loosen up the mood and at the same time to position themselves as the entertaining challenger.
With his McDonald’s visit, Trump increases the media attention to his campaign. These types of appearances are designed to create a image of the candidate as a down-to-earth man, which could help him win voters in a head-to-head race. On November 5, Trump and Harris face each other in a crucial election battle, whereby every appearance is strategically planned to obtain voting.
